How much do entry level qa testing jobs pay per hour?

As of Jun 16, 2026, the average hourly pay for entry level qa testing in California is $22.89,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$17.31 and $23.94 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an Entry Level QA Tester, and why are they important?

To thrive as an Entry Level QA Tester, you need a strong understanding of software development fundamentals, attention to detail, and a bachelor’s degree in computer science or a related field. Familiarity with test case management tools, bug tracking systems like JIRA, and basic knowledge of automation tools such as Selenium are commonly required. Strong analytical thinking, communication skills, and a collaborative mindset help testers effectively identify, report, and resolve issues. These skills ensure software quality, reduce defects, and support a smooth development process within the team.

Entry Level Qa Testing focuses on executing test cases and identifying bugs, often with less responsibility for test planning. Quality Assurance Analysts typically have a broader role, including test planning, process improvement, and documentation. Both roles require similar credentials and are used interchangeably in many organizations, but QA Analysts usually have more experience and responsibilities.

How do I become a QA tester with no experience?

To become an entry-level QA tester with no experience, focus on learning basic testing concepts, software development life cycle, and common testing tools like Selenium or Jira. Gaining certifications such as ISTQB can also improve your chances, and building a portfolio of practice tests or volunteering for testing projects can demonstrate your skills to employers.

What are some typical challenges that entry-level QA testers face when starting in the role?

Entry-level QA testers often encounter challenges such as quickly learning new testing tools, understanding complex software requirements, and adapting to fast-paced development cycles. They may also need to develop effective communication skills to report bugs clearly and collaborate with developers and other team members. Overcoming these challenges involves proactive learning, seeking guidance from experienced colleagues, and staying organized to manage multiple tasks efficiently.

Is QA replaced by AI?

Entry Level QA Testing involves manual and automated testing to identify software defects. While AI tools can assist in test case generation and bug detection, they do not fully replace human testers, especially for understanding complex user scenarios and interpreting results. QA roles continue to evolve with technology, emphasizing skills in automation tools and critical thinking.

What are entry level QA testers?

Entry level QA testers are professionals who begin their careers in software quality assurance by testing applications, websites, or systems for bugs and ensuring they meet specified requirements. Their responsibilities often include executing test cases, reporting defects, and working closely with developers and other team members to improve product quality. Entry level QA testers typically use manual testing methods, but may also learn basic automation tools. These roles require strong attention to detail, analytical thinking, and good communication skills. Most entry level positions do not require extensive prior experience, making them a good starting point for a career in software testing.
